本文目录一览:
如何用php生成一个16位数的id 并在指定的文件创建id文件夹
1234?php$id = substr(md5(uniqid()), 0,16);mkdir('./abc/'.$id);?
uniqid()
生成一个唯一的id值,在MD5加密成32位数完后,截取16为的字符。
在当前目录下abc目录下创建文件夹。
望采纳
Thx
php 如何生成16位随机数?只有数字
有点投机取巧的意味
lt;?php
$a = mt_rand(10000000,99999999);
$b = mt_rand(10000000,99999999);
echo $a.$b;
还有一种方法
?php
$a = range(0,9);
for($i=0;$i16;$i++){
$b[] = array_rand($a);
}
var_dump(join("",$b));
//结果string(16) "0179571910024734"
php随机数生成的函数是?
php提供的随机数函数rand(),rand()函数将返回随机整数,具体使用方法如下:rand(min,max)
可选参数min和max可以使rand() 返回0到rand_max之间的伪随机整数,例如,想要5到15(包括 5 和 15)之间的随机数,用 rand(5, 15)